Man, you folks really don't make these contests easy. Collectively you're all full of good ideas, and it's going to take me months to add as many of these as I'd like to. More than 30 items made it through my first pass, and a dozen even in my second pass. There's just a lot of good, creative stuff to choose from.

Computer and transportation items seemed to be popular, so I may look into more of those. Changing the computer system is downright nightmarish, so I'm not quite sure what I can do there, but I'll give it some serious thought.

Honorable mentions:
* Pentameter by blackmatter615
* Empire's Glasses by LiiLii2
* Epic Flail by Jesus
* Song of the Siren and Ryme of the Ancient Mariner by Seventhcross
* Battle bot by Babbolonien
* Brick Outhouse by DuRhone
* Knight Writer by Lichen
* Staff of the crusader, by Fly Die0
* Palindrone by The Mighty Coyote
* Holy Hand Grenade Launcher by The Leopard


Top prize goes to:
Blatz for telekenetic katana + malkamite = Cranky Old Bastard Sword

Good pun, great name, fits the theme, and even other competitors were pulling for it.

Second prize goes to:
Sanjuro for robocap + malkamite = Flinty Beret

We *do* need more GI Joe references in the game. Also, fantastic choice of the word "flinty" to fit in with the malkamite theme.

Third prize goes to:
Aariana for paladinum + threeinforced cap = Defender of the Crown

Old video game reference and witty combination with the paladinum/defender theme make this a winner.


Conclusion:

You guys are never going to believe this, but I've already implemented the three winning recipes! I'm going to need a few days (or a few weeks, or whatever) to get moving on some of the other recipes (there's a whole bunch I'm very excited to make use of).

Winners will get their prizes shortly, and for these or any other recipes as I implement them I'll deliver 50 of that item to the creator.
